## Deployment

The Fernlock autocomplete index rebuilds nightly and is known to be slow on the Harwick cluster — a full rebuild takes around 40 minutes, during which suggestions may lag or return stale entries. Support should not escalate rebuild-window slowness as an incident. If customers report delays outside the nightly window, check whether an ad-hoc reindex was triggered. The rebuild job reads its tuning parameters from the deployment manifest, which currently contains the following values.

settings of tagef-bawif:
DRUIX_HOST=druix.zemvarlabs.internal
DRUIX_PORT=8000

## Tuning undo/redo

The Inklattice editor keeps undo history in a ring buffer per canvas. If on-call sees memory spikes, it's almost always someone pasting a 5,000-node diagram and then mashing undo. Snapshots are taken on a stroke-count interval, with deltas in between. The knobs worth touching live in one place, and their current values are shown below.

tuning constants:
QUOTAS = {
    "quenael": 10,
    "oliwyn": 1,
}

## Build Provenance — Sheafline CSV Import Wizard

All wizard artifacts are built on the Ostermark pipeline from a pinned toolchain manifest; no local builds ship. Column-mapping heuristics are generated at build time, so reproducing a release requires the exact manifest revision. Provenance attestations are archived for five years. To match a deployed wizard against its attestation record, use the token below.

trace token, fafog-kageg: htk4_98e6

# --- Tilecache settings (discussed at weekly sync) ---
# The render cache for Mapfell tiles now evicts by zoom level
# instead of plain LRU. High-zoom tiles are cheap to rebuild,
# so they go first; zoom 0-6 tiles stay pinned. TTL stays at
# 6 hours until we see how the eviction churn looks in prod.
# Bring numbers to Thursday's sync if hit rate drops under 90%.
# Cache metadata is persisted to the store at the connection below.

replica DSN, kajep-yahag: mssql://praok_svc:iF@db-8d68.plorvaio.local:5432/eliion